Porter County Sheriff’s Department Wins Battle of the Badges Tourney

PC-Sheriff-Battle-of-BadgesPorter County Sheriff’s Department fought off seven other teams to claim the Championship title of the 5th Annual Battle of the Badges Tournament. Teams from local police and fire departments played in a bracketed basketball tournament hosted by Boys & Girls Clubs of Porter County-South Haven Club on May 18th and May 19th.

Participating teams were from: South Haven Fire Department, Chesterton Police Department, Hebron Police Departments, Porter County Sheriff’s Department, Portage Police Department, Indiana State Police, Valparaiso Fire Department and Team BGCPOCO. Porter County Sheriff’s Department defeated the Indiana State Police 74-60 in the title game. Words of remembrance and a moment of silence were offered for fallen Porter County Sheriff Officer Phillip Pratt before each game.

Proceeds from the tournament benefitted the activities and programs at the Boys & Girls Clubs of Porter County-South Haven Club.

Boys & Girls Clubs of Porter County has been serving youth for 40 years. The Clubs provide programs for nearly 5,000 boys and girls in the areas of character and leadership development, educational enhancement, career preparation, health and life skills, the arts and sports, fitness and recreation.
